Meeting Mr Stanley Francis age 100 World War 2 Veteran Royal Air Force

An epic story of from a veteran who, as a young boy, wanted some excitement and fun. The idea of enlisting in the Royal Air Force very much appealed to him shortly after leaving. Travelling from his world and existence in Jamaica to Mother a England was quite an experience. The sense of adventure and youthful exuberance propelled him and his colleagues to achieve their best, both in schooling and out in the big wide world.

Editor’s Note

Yet another story of how it was decades ago, in times of conflict, but also experiencing the lack of knowledge that the indigenous people of Britain had about people of African descent. There was a general perception that black people had tails, as Stanley said.
